Помогите с фотогалереей!
- Предыдущая
- 1
- 2
- Показаны 16-18 из 18
2. Если первый пункт не дал результатов, значит мы добрались до файла frontend.php и по умолчанию выводится блок $do == view. Здесь уже 404 страница просто так не берется. Должно быть явное перенаправление. В блоке этого нет. Но есть в файле model.php. Функция getAlbum(). Вот она и может давать 404 страницу, потому что не может взять корневую категорию. Это я просто для разъяснения. Если не понятно, можете просто пропустить. Как исправить?
— первый вариант, в админке проверить дерево каталогов. Настройки->Проверка деревьев. Если найдены ошибки в дереве фотоальбомов, значит исправляем. При этом пропадет вся вложенность. Придется по новой составлять дерево альбомов. Если не помогло, значит смотрим далее
— второе. Придется лезть в БД. Найти таблицу cms_photo_albums и проверить (если нет — создать) есть ли корневой альбом. При этом в поле parent_id корневого альбома должно быть значение 0, а поле NSDiffer должно быть пустое. Это важно, именно по этому условию берется корневой альбом. Теперь смотрим поле id этого альбома. По умолчанию оно 100. Далее ищем наши альбомы второго уровня, которые являются дочерними корневого альбома. У этих альбомов поле parent_id должно быть равно id корневого альбома(по умолчанию равно 100). И поле NSDiffer должен быть пустым. Записи, где NSDiffer не пустое не трогаем. Это альбомы клубов, личные...
После всего этого возможно придется опять править дерево альбомов. Ошибка скорее всего в том, что нет корневого альбома. Проверьте.
Взял один из альбомов групповых, и сделал из него корневой, затем дерево=)
сейчас пошёл тестровать и настраивать !
Спасибо =)
- Предыдущая
- 1
- 2
- Показаны 16-18 из 18